Should You Buy a 2010 Ford Transit Connect?
The 2010 Ford Transit Connect is a versatile minivan designed primarily for commercial use but also appeals to families seeking practicality. With a front-wheel-drive system and a 2.0L I4 engine producing 136 hp and 128 lb-ft of torque, it offers decent performance for city driving. The vehicle achieves a combined fuel economy of 23 MPG, making it a cost-effective choice for daily commutes or business errands. Its MSRP of $21,540 positions it competitively in the market for budget-conscious buyers looking for utility without sacrificing comfort, as it seats four passengers comfortably.
However, potential buyers should be aware of some reliability concerns. The NHTSA has recorded 56 complaints, with notable issues in the powertrain and electrical systems. Despite this, the Transit Connect boasts a high reliability score of 98.8/100, indicating that many owners have had positive experiences. Overall, this vehicle is ideal for those needing a practical, fuel-efficient option for both work and family use.
This vehicle is best suited for small business owners or families looking for a practical, fuel-efficient minivan that offers versatility without breaking the bank.

Known Issues (NHTSA Data)
The 2010 Ford Transit Connect has reported a total of 56 complaints to the NHTSA, with the most frequent issues related to the powertrain and electrical systems. While there have been 8 crash incidents and 2 fire incidents, no fatalities have been reported.
